GRAEF
was established in 1961 and has grown to a staff of over 300, including professional engineers, scientists, architects, planners and technical specialists. GRAEF’s Headquarters are in Milwaukee, WI, with 8 other offices in Green Bay and Madison, WI; 2 offices in Chicago; one in Minneapolis, MN; and 3 Florida offices in Orlando, Miami and Sarasota. GRAEF’s goal is to provide quality professional engineering services to solve clients’ needs in the most cost‑effective way through technical competence, innovation, creativity, and high motivation. The firm serves major markets including structural, public works, industrial/architectural, planning, landscape architecture, environmental, transportation, construction, mechanical, plumbing and electrical services.
